BaiduMap_IOSSDK_v6.6.2_Docs 6.6.2
载入中...
搜索中...
未找到
属性 | 所有成员列表
BMKHeatMap类 参考

热力图的绘制数据和显示样式类 更多...

#include <BMKHeatMap.h>

类 BMKHeatMap 继承关系图:

属性

id< BMKHeatMapDelegatedelegate
 热力图代理方法,since 6.5.0
 
int mRadius
 设置热力图点半径 (像素),默认为12px,当mRadiusIsMeter为NO时生效,范围[10~50]
 
BOOL mRadiusIsMeter
 设置热力图点半径单位是否是米,默认为NO,范围[10~50],since 6.5.7
 
int mRadiusMeter
 设置热力图点半径(米),默认为12米,当mRadiusIsMeter为YES时生效,范围[10~50],since 6.5.7
 
int mMaxShowLevel
 设置热力图最大显示等级,默认为22,范围[4~22],since 6.5.7
 
int mMinShowLevel
 设置热力图最小显示等级,默认为4,范围[4~22],since 6.5.7
 
int mMaxHight
 设置3D热力图最大高度,默认为0ps,范围[0~200],since 6.5.0
 
double mMaxIntensity
 设置热力图最大权重值,默认为1.0,since 6.5.0
 
double mMinIntensity
 设置热力图最小权重值,默认为0.0,since 6.5.0
 
BMKGradientmGradient
 设置热力图渐变,有默认值 DEFAULT_GRADIENT
 
double mOpacity
 设置热力图层透明度,默认 0.6,范围[0~1]
 
NSArray< BMKHeatMapNode * > * mData
 
NSArray< NSArray< BMKHeatMapNode * > * > * mDatas
 用户传入的热力图数据,数组,成员类型为NSArray <BMKHeatMapNode *>,用于帧动画,since 6.5.0
 
BMKAnimationanimation
 设置第一次显示时的动画属性,默认为nil
 
BMKAnimationframeAnimation
 设置帧动画属性,默认为nil
 

详细描述

热力图的绘制数据和显示样式类

属性说明

◆ animation

- (BMKAnimation*) animation
readwritenonatomicstrong

设置第一次显示时的动画属性,默认为nil

◆ delegate

- (id<BMKHeatMapDelegate>) delegate
readwritenonatomicweak

热力图代理方法,since 6.5.0

◆ frameAnimation

- (BMKAnimation*) frameAnimation
readwritenonatomicstrong

设置帧动画属性,默认为nil

◆ mData

- (NSArray<BMKHeatMapNode *>*) mData
readwritenonatomiccopy

用户传入的热力图数据mData和mDatas ,二选一,优先mDatas 用户传入的热力图数据,数组,成员类型为BMKHeatMapNode

◆ mDatas

- (NSArray<NSArray <BMKHeatMapNode *> *>*) mDatas
readwritenonatomiccopy

用户传入的热力图数据,数组,成员类型为NSArray <BMKHeatMapNode *>,用于帧动画,since 6.5.0

◆ mGradient

- (BMKGradient*) mGradient
readwritenonatomicstrong

设置热力图渐变,有默认值 DEFAULT_GRADIENT

◆ mMaxHight

- (int) mMaxHight
readwritenonatomicassign

设置3D热力图最大高度,默认为0ps,范围[0~200],since 6.5.0

◆ mMaxIntensity

- (double) mMaxIntensity
readwritenonatomicassign

设置热力图最大权重值,默认为1.0,since 6.5.0

◆ mMaxShowLevel

- (int) mMaxShowLevel
readwritenonatomicassign

设置热力图最大显示等级,默认为22,范围[4~22],since 6.5.7

◆ mMinIntensity

- (double) mMinIntensity
readwritenonatomicassign

设置热力图最小权重值,默认为0.0,since 6.5.0

◆ mMinShowLevel

- (int) mMinShowLevel
readwritenonatomicassign

设置热力图最小显示等级,默认为4,范围[4~22],since 6.5.7

◆ mOpacity

- (double) mOpacity
readwritenonatomicassign

设置热力图层透明度,默认 0.6,范围[0~1]

◆ mRadius

- (int) mRadius
readwritenonatomicassign

设置热力图点半径 (像素),默认为12px,当mRadiusIsMeter为NO时生效,范围[10~50]

◆ mRadiusIsMeter

- (BOOL) mRadiusIsMeter
readwritenonatomicassign

设置热力图点半径单位是否是米,默认为NO,范围[10~50],since 6.5.7

◆ mRadiusMeter

- (int) mRadiusMeter
readwritenonatomicassign

设置热力图点半径(米),默认为12米,当mRadiusIsMeter为YES时生效,范围[10~50],since 6.5.7


该类的文档由以下文件生成: